lib/bpf: add missing limits.h includes

Several functions in bpf_glue.c and bpf_libbpf.c rely on PATH_MAX, which is
normally included from <limits.h> in other iproute2 source files.

It fixes errors seen using gcc 10.2.0, binutils 2.35.1 and musl 1.1.24:

bpf_glue.c: In function 'get_libbpf_version':
bpf_glue.c:46:11: error: 'PATH_MAX' undeclared (first use in this function);
did you mean 'AF_MAX'?
   46 |  char buf[PATH_MAX], *s;
      |           ^~~~~~~~
      |           AF_MAX
